tetchcgEven as a child, Tetch sought her sacred work through writing. As an idealistic youth she found meaning in “love for country.” Then she looked outside herself for purpose as an editor. In midlife, she discovered the holy contract in her deepest core. It is to live for God. She listened to Him in the silence and she spoke to Him in verses.

Tetch discovered the stillness through journal writing which helped her connect to her soul and reclaim the writer within. Through trekking and other adventures in nature, Tetch and her husband Jorge discovered the sanctifying element in their marriage. The union of her free verse and her husband’s nature photographs in the Philippines gave birth to “Lumine: Finding the Light.”
